Arrival | Patrick Almond joins on season-long loan from Sunderland

14th January 2022

Blyth Spartans are pleased to announce the signing of Sunderland defender Patrick Almond on loan until the end of season. The 19-year-old has so far made the one appearance for the Black Cats, as he played the full 90 minutes for Lee Johnson’s side in their EFL Trophy win over Manchester United under-21s in October. Arrival | Agnew joins Blyth Spartans

24th September 2020

Blyth Spartans AFC is delighted to announce the arrival of Liam Agnew from League Two side Harrogate Town.  The midfielder, 25, reunites with manager Michael Nelson having worked and played alongside him at Gateshead last season.  Agnew progressed through the youth ranks at Sunderland, captaining their under-21s before making his only first team appearance in an FA Cup tie versus Fulham in 2015. Club statement | Spartans appoint Lee Clark as new manager

1st June 2019

Blyth Spartans are delighted to announce the appointment of former England International and Newcastle United midfielder Lee Clark as their new first team manager. Clark, 46, brings a wealth of Football League experience having previously managed Huddersfield Town, Birmingham City, Blackpool and Bury, whilst also managing Kilmarnock in Scotland The midfielder made 528 appearances in his professional career, scoring 66 goals, most notably for Newcastle United, Sunderland and Fulham. Arrival | Midfielder Connor Oliver signs on the dotted line

3rd August 2018

Blyth Spartans are delighted to announce the club’s seventh summer signing as midfielder Connor Oliver joins the club. The 24-year-old spent last season with National League side Halifax Town – making 20 appearances for the Shaymen last season. Born in Newcastle, Oliver began his career with the Sunderland Academy before joining then League Two Hartlepool United in 2014, but only made three appearances before joining Championship side Blackpool.
